The NYCO Society is dedicated to the quality performance of classical music by encouraging participation and development among a large community membership, and appreciation and enrichment for a broad public. NYCO supports a diverse and talented membership of over 50 musicians who perform in the NYCO Symphony Orchestra and the NYCO Chamber Players. Professional string section leaders and Music Director and Conductor, David Bowser, provide the guidance, training and inspiration for NYCO to achieve excellence.
NYCO offers audiences of all ages exposure to classical music and musicians of all ages exciting performance opportunities.
The NYCO Symphony Orchestra offers an affordable four-concert subscription series at St. Michael’s College School Performing Arts Centre. Additionally, NYCO performs to a broad audience through impactful outreach and community programs throughout the city. To further meet our goal of bringing classical music to the community, the NYCO Chamber Players perform an education concert series in schools and community centres across Toronto.
